FLIGHT TEST SYSTEM MARKET OVERVIEW

The global flight test system market market size was valued at approximately USD 0.33 billion in 2024 and is expected to reach USD 0.78 billion by 2033, growing at CAGR of about 11.5% during the forecast period.

Flight test systems contain more than a few state-of-the-art tools designed to assess aircraft overall performance, protection, and functionality. These systems consist of superior instrumentation including sensors, facts acquisition devices, and telemetry structures that gather critical flight data. Additionally, simulation software permits engineers to version numerous flight scenarios and examine aircraft behavior in exclusive conditions. Ground help device allows checking out strategies by using presenting infrastructure for maintenance, calibration, and troubleshooting. Flight takes a look at systems find packages throughout the aerospace enterprise, from comparing prototype designs to certifying plane for industrial use, ensuring that plane meet stringent protection and performance standards before entering carrier.

FLIGHT TEST SYSTEM MARKET SEGMENTATION

By Type

Depending on flight test system market given are types: Equipment, Service. The Equipment type will capture the maximum market share through 2028.  

  • Equipment Segment: This contains a huge variety of physical hardware utilized in flight testing, which includes sensors, data acquisition gadgets, telemetry systems, simulation software program, and ground support system. It captures the most important marketplace percentage because of the ongoing call for superior trying out instrumentation and infrastructure to evaluate aircraft performance and protection.
  • Service Segment: The carrier segment consists of quite a few checking out and consultancy offerings supplied by means of specialized firms to assist flight testing activities. These services might also include check making plans, facts evaluation, certification help, and training. While critical for complete checking out applications, the carrier phase generally holds a smaller marketplace percentage compared to gadget, reflecting the dominance of hardware in the flight test gadget market.

By Application

The market is divided into Civil, Military based on application. The global flight test system market players in cover segment like Civil will dominate the market share during 2022-2028.

  • Civil Segment: The civil section makes a specialty of flight trying out activities related to industrial and civilian aircraft, which include passenger airplanes, shipment planes, and helicopters. This segment dominates the marketplace share due to the increasing call for safer and more efficient business aviation, riding investments in advanced flight trying out technologies and services.
  • Military Segment: The navy section involves flight checking out for protection and army plane, such as fighter jets, delivery planes, and reconnaissance drones. While important for national safety and protection preparedness, this section commonly holds a smaller marketplace percentage as compared to civil aviation because of fewer procurement packages and specialized checking out requirements.

INDUSTRIAL DEVELOPMENT

June 2022: Curtiss-Wright Corporation announced a great commercial improvement by introducing a new line of superior flight check instrumentation systems. These systems include contemporary era to enhance records acquisition and analysis competencies during aircraft testing. With capabilities which includes excessive-pace statistics recording, real-time telemetry, and compatibility with numerous plane platforms, Curtiss-Wright pursuits to deal with the evolving wishes of the aerospace industry for greater efficient and complete flight trying out solutions.
